How they compare
Germany currently reports 1,748 against 924 in Greece, a difference of 824.
That makes Germany's figure about 1.9 times Greece's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 8 shared years of data; in 2016 it was Greece ahead.
Germany ranks 2nd and Greece ranks 3rd of 104 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Germany averaged higher in 1 and Greece in 1.
